Understanding the three prong versus four prong standard differences

In many kitchens, you will encounter two distinct electrical configurations for stoves. Older installations used a three prong cord that combines the grounding path with the neutral conductor. Modern practice separates ground and neutral and relies on a four prong cord. A stove 3 prong to 4 prong adapter is a device intended to bridge the mismatch between a legacy three‑prong appliance and a four‑prong outlet by creating a separate ground path while keeping the neutral isolated. It is important to note that this is typically a stopgap measure rather than a permanent solution. According to Stove Recipe Hub, the safest long‑term approach is upgrading wiring or replacing the outlet to meet current four‑wire standards. Understanding these differences helps you assess whether an adapter is appropriate for your home and how to minimize risk while you plan a proper electrical upgrade.

How to choose a high quality adapter

When shopping for an adapter, look for listings from reputable safety organizations such as UL or ETL. A quality adapter should have a robust cord, clearly labeled voltage and amperage ratings, and protective housings for all conductors. Ensure the adapter provides a dedicated path for ground and does not rely on bonding the chassis to the neutral in a way that could create shock hazards. Note that many jurisdictions discourage long term use of adapters and encourage proper wiring upgrades. Safe installation and usage practices

Begin with a full power shutdown and ensure the appliance is unplugged before handling any connections. Inspect both the outlet and the adapter for signs of wear, heat damage, or fraying. Use a professional-rated cord with adequate gauge and avoid daisy‑chaining adapters with other devices. If you suspect improper grounding or signs of arcing, discontinue use immediately and consult a licensed electrician. Always follow local codes and product instructions. The goal is to minimize risk while planning a future upgrade that brings the kitchen up to current safety standards.

Alternatives to adapters

The most robust alternative to an adapter is upgrading the outlet and wiring to support a four‑wire configuration. This frequently involves installing a four‑prong outlet and replacing or reconfiguring the range cord to a four‑prong type. In some cases, a dedicated circuit and correctly sized breaker are required. If you rent or cannot modify wiring, consult a licensed electrician about temporary, code‑compliant options and long‑term plans. Maintenance and troubleshooting with adapters

Regular inspection is key: check the adapter and outlet for warmth after use, listen for crackling or buzzing, and look for discoloration or sizzling at the connection. If the adapter becomes hot to the touch, or if you notice any odor of burnt insulation, cease use and have the system evaluated. Have a professional test the circuit integrity and grounding. Routine maintenance of kitchen outlets and cords helps prevent faults that can lead to shocks or fire hazards.
